0

リポジトリのブランチで「gitsvndcommit」を実行すると、次のエラーが発生します。

HTTP Path Not Found: PROPFIND request failed on '/svn/Project/branches/3.34': '/svn/Project/branches/3.34' path not found at C:\Program Files (x86)\Git/libexec/git-core\git-svn line 4970

ただし、「gitsvnfetch」および「gitsvnrebase」は正常に機能します。そして、メイントランクも問題なく動作します。助言がありますか?

ああ、注目に値するのは、svnの実際のパスは3.34だけでなく/ svn / Project / branchs/v3.34でなければならないということです。しかし、上記のように、私が定期的に使用する他のコマンドは、dcommitを壊す部分でも正常に機能します。

4

1 に答える 1

0

このソリューションは、dcommitで保留しているコミットの数によっては機能しない場合がありますが、コミットが1つあるため、ローカルブランチを削除し、3.34ではなくv3.34名を使用してローカルブランチを再作成すると、dcommitが魔法のように機能し始めました。

于 2012-07-10T17:25:18.503 に答える